Koya was the birthplace of … WebOct 25, 2016 · Alongside the Shrine of the Book, where the Dead Sea Scrolls are housed, is a model of Jerusalem in the Second Temple period. It represents Jerusalem in 66 C.E. on the eve of the Jews’ Great Revolt against the Romans. A model of Jerusalem and the ancient Temple itself in the Second Temple period at the Israel Museum, October 2016.

WebBritish researchers started excavating the Western Wall in the mid 19th century. Charles Wilson began the excavations in 1864 and was followed by Charles Warren in 1867–70. Wilson discovered an arch now named for him, "Wilson's Arch" which was 12.8 metres (42 ft) wide and is above present-day ground level.It is believed that the arch supported a bridge …
